Purchasing Power Analysis
A Commercial and Industrial Designers in Wood Dale, IL earns $57,630 in nominal terms, which is 4% below the national average of $60,000. After adjusting for the local cost of living (index 92.3 vs national 100), this is equivalent to $62,438 in national-average purchasing power.
Tax differences are not included. Only cost-of-living index adjustments are applied.
